What It Is

acousticscale.org is an academic wiki knowledge base maintained by the UK's CNBH (Centre for the Neural Basis of Hearing). Its theme centers on "bioacoustic communication"—how animal calls, speech, and music are produced, how the auditory system processes them, and how humans perceive them. Its core focus is the "size information" carried in sound, studying how the size of a sound-producing body affects the acoustic scale information within a sound.

Core Features

The site organizes its content around three sections:

  • Bio-Comm Sounds: Explains two forms of size information—glottal pulse rate and vocal tract length.
  • Auditory Processing: Based on the Auditory Image Model (AIM) proposed by Patterson and colleagues, with videos illustrating how the auditory system separates the fine temporal structure of sound (pitch, timbre) from the temporal envelope (auditory event dynamics). It also references two computational toolsets, AIM-MAT and AIM-C, implemented in Matlab/C.
  • Auditory Perception: A collection of research papers and projects on the role of acoustic scale and auditory images in perception.

It is essentially a read-only knowledge repository. Unlike a traditional wiki, it isn't open for discussion or public editing—external contributions must be submitted in wiki format and added by the administrators after review.

Pricing

Completely free. It is a non-commercial academic public-interest resource, with no paywall or registration barriers whatsoever.

Pros and Cons

Pros: The content is fairly professional and in-depth within the niche field of auditory scale, accompanied by diagrams and videos, and it provides authoritative literature citations and links to computational models—offering clear value to relevant researchers.

Cons: The page was last modified in May 2014, so the content is clearly stagnant. The interface uses the old default MediaWiki style and feels dated. Its audience is extremely narrow, making it nearly useless for non-specialists. And since it isn't open for editing, community interaction is weak.

Who It's For

Suitable for researchers and graduate students in psychoacoustics, speech processing, and auditory neuroscience, as well as developers interested in the Auditory Image Model (AIM). Ordinary users have essentially no need to visit.
